  • 1. Please give an overview of your role and what this involves on a day-to-day basis:
  • Trainee dairy technologist involved in food trials, data analysis and collection. Implementation of theory learnt at college. Assignments

    6/10

  • 2. Have you learnt any new skills or developed existing skills?
  • Developed problem solving skills, data collection and scientific research. Level 3 Health and safety at work and Level 2 food safety

    8/10

  • 10. What tips or advice would you give to others applying to Arla Foods?
  • Be yourself and keep calm,whatever will be will be with everyone ive ever met being positive kind and more than willing to give you there time. during onboarding take all the opportunities you can to build a base knowledge of how the site works and the products they produce. fully embrace the LEAN culture and get an understanding as soon as you can
